HITACHI Regulator: Testing: Relay: I-Mark
- Connect voltmeter between negative terminal and ground and increase engine speed gradually. Voltmeter reading should be 4.0-5.8 volts. If cut-in voltage is too high, adjust by bending coil arm "A" down. Bend up if voltage is too low, See Fig 1.
- If adjustment of core arm does not correct cut-in voltage, proceed with point gap adjustment. Disconnect battery. Check armature core gap with armature depressed until moving point is in contact with "B" side point.
- Adjust core gap to 0.012" (0.30 mm) by bending point arm "B". Release armature and adjust gap between "B" side point and moving point to 0.016 - 0.047" (0.40 - 1.2 mm) by bending point arm "C". After point adjustment, recheck cut-in voltage. If not within 4.0-5.8 volts, repeat cut-in voltage adjustment.
